Check out Saturday's biggest line moves:

Maryland at Florida State

The Seminoles opened as 16.5-point favorites, but saw that number expand to 18 as of Friday night. And it’s easy to see why no one has faith in the Terrapins. Maryland is 2-7-1 ATS this season and is allowing more than 32 points per game. The Terrapins also are 4-10 ATS in their past 14 games against the Seminoles.

Florida International at Florida

The Gators already were slated to take a chomp out of the Golden Panthers, opening as 41-point favorites. But that number rocketed as high as 45 points with many books as bettors expect Florida to shred the visiting defense. Florida International is just 1-5 on the road this season and is allowing more than 33 points per game. This should be a tune up for the Gators.

Iowa State at Missouri

The Tigers opened as 13 point favorites, but saw that number balloon to 15.5 with many books later in the week as sharps were all over the Tigers. This is a curious move, as Missouri is 1-7 ATS in its past eight games against teams with a winning record and is a horrendous 1-3 ATS in its past four games against Iowa State. Missouri also will be without starting receiver Jare Perry.

Texas Christian at Wyoming

The Cowboys better cowboy up. Texas Christian started as a 28.5-point favorite, but saw that number rise as many as three points with some books, as bettors jumped all over the hottest team in the country coming off an absolute beat down of Utah. The Horned Frogs also are 3-0-1 in their past four meetings with the Cowboys.

UAB at East Carolina

The Blazers have won three straight, but no one believes in UAB’s defense, which allows 31.7 points per game. The Blazers opened as 10-point underdogs, but that number grew to 13 point during the week as the improving Pirates garnered a huge swath of the action. East Carolina is 3-1 ATS in its past four games overall and 3-1 ATS in its past four games against UAB.

Air Force at Brigham Young

The Cougars have dominated this series lately and it showed with the spread, as it opened at 7.5 points but grew to as many as 10 by Friday night. BYU has won the past five meetings and is 5-0 ATS during that span, winning by an average of 19 points. The Cougars also are scoring more than 35 points per game this season.

San Diego State at Utah

History says that the Aztecs have no chance in this meeting – and the line movement seems to agree. The Utes opened as 17-point favorites and that line has moved to as many as 20 as of Friday night. Utah is 5-1 ATS in its past six games against San Diego State, the Aztecs are allowing 30 points per game and are a horrid 3-7 ATS this season.

Kansas State at Nebraska

Not many bettors think that the Wildcats are back. Kansas State opened as a 14-point underdog and saw that number increase to as high as 17 with some books. The reason? Kansas State is 0-4 on the road this season and 0-3 ATS against the Cornhuskers the past three season. Over that span, the Wildcats have yielded an average of 50 points per game.
